Gloo Holdings Reports Strong Q1 Results, Raises FY26 Guidance, and Acquires Remaining Midwestern Stake
Summary
Gloo Holdings reported Q1 revenue growth of 238% year-over-year, significantly reduced its net loss, and improved Adjusted EBITDA, leading to a raised fiscal year 2026 revenue guidance and a clearer path to profitability. The company also acquired the remaining 20% stake in Midwestern Interactive, removing a $12.1 million liability.

Strong Q1 Financial Performance
Total revenue for Q1 2026 grew 238% year-over-year to $41.5 million, exceeding guidance and analyst consensus. Net loss improved to $17.1 million from $27.0 million in the prior year, and Adjusted EBITDA was negative $11.5 million, beating estimates and showing sequential improvement.

Raised Fiscal Year 2026 Guidance
Gloo Holdings raised its fiscal year 2026 revenue guidance to $195.0 million, reflecting increased confidence in its growth trajectory.

Clear Path to Profitability
The company reiterated its expectation to approach Adjusted EBITDA breakeven in Q3 2026 and achieve Adjusted EBITDA profitability in Q4 2026, demonstrating consistent progress towards financial stability.

Acquisition of Remaining Midwestern Interactive Stake
Gloo Holdings announced a definitive agreement to acquire the remaining 20% stake in Midwestern Interactive, bringing its ownership to 100% and consolidating a strategic asset.
Analysis
This filing marks a significant positive shift for Gloo Holdings, directly addressing the 'substantial doubt' about its ability to continue as a going concern disclosed in its recent 10-K. The company reported robust Q1 revenue growth, significantly improved profitability metrics, and raised its full-year guidance, indicating strong operational execution. Furthermore, the acquisition of the remaining stake in Midwestern Interactive not only consolidates a strategic asset but also removes a material $12.1 million liability from the balance sheet, strengthening the company's financial position and accelerating its path to profitability.
